Not that it matters much, but according to this LA Times article from this morning ( [URL="http://latimesblogs.latimes.com/lanow/2013/02/dorner-manhunt-authorities-gear-up-for-continued-search-in-big-bear.html"LINK[/URL]), it was the LAPD that shot to the two women and Torrance PD were the shooters in the 2nd incident.
Quote:
About 5:20 a.m. in Torrance, two women were delivering the Los Angeles Times from their blue pickup when LAPD officers spotted the truck.
The police apparently mistook the truck for Dorner's and riddled it with bullets. The women, a mother-and-daughter team, were rushed to a hospital.
The mother, who is in her 70s, was shot in the shoulder. She was listed in stable condition. Her daughter was injured by shattered glass.
About 25 minutes after that shooting, Torrance police opened fire after spotting another truck similar to Dorner's at Flagler Lane and Beryl Street. No one was reported hurt.
